What is Heat Sink Silicone
Heat sink silicone is a thermal compound that is used to transfer heat away from electronic components. It is made up of a combination of silicone, metal oxide, and other materials that help to enhance its thermal conductivity. This compound is applied between the surface of a heat-generating component, such as a processor or graphics card, and the heat sink.

Types of Heat Sink Silicone
Two types of heat sink silicone are commonly used: thermal paste and thermal pads.
Thermal Paste
Thermal paste is a thick, viscous compound that is applied to the heat sink and the electronic component to create a thin and even layer. It is best suited for surfaces that are relatively flat and require a high degree of contact between the component and the sink.
Thermal Pads
Thermal pads are made of a soft and flexible material that is pre-cut to the size and shape of the electronic component. They are easy to use and require no messy cleanup. They are best suited for components that are less flat and require more contact pressure.
Application of Heat Sink Silicone
Applying heat sink silicone requires careful and precise handling to ensure optimal performance and effectiveness. The following steps should be followed:
- Clean the surface of the electronic component and the heat sink
- Apply a small amount of heat sink silicone to the center of the component's surface
- Spread the paste evenly across the surface of the component using a plastic applicator
- Secure the heat sink to the component with screws or clips
